"Wilson Tominey are delighted to offer this Beautiful, spacious ground floor apartment in a historic former barracks. The building offers many character features including high ceilings and sash windows, and is located at The Nothe near the famous Nothe Fort and gardens, just a short distance from the picturesque harbour and award winning beach. The apartment offers a lovely double aspect lounge with feature sash windows and large double bedroom. Outside there is allocated parking.

The property would make an ideal holiday home with viewings highly recommended to appreciate the benefits this property has to offer.
